Basketball—Coaches
The 2012-13 season marks Dedrick Shannon's ninth
as head coach of the Cyclones. Shannon, a point guard on the 1995-96 team,
returned to Moraine Valley in 2004 with six years of coaching experience. He led his
talented 2011-12 squad to the NJCAA Division II Championship, a first in his
tenure, after winning the NJCAA Region IV Championship and being crowned
co-champs in the Illinois Skyway Collegiate Conference. He also was selected as
the 2012 Illinois Basketball Coaches Association Co-Coach of the Year in NJCAA
Division II. In the 2008-09 season, Shannon led his squad to a 28-5 season, ranking as high as 12th in NJCAA
Division II, and a Skyway championship. After these successful seasons, Shannon
earned 2011-12 and 2008-09 Skyway Conference Coach of the Year and Skyway Male
Coach of the Year. He also was the 2012 Region IV Coach of the Year.
Before coaching at Moraine
Valley, Shannon helped manage an independent basketball club/travel team. In
addition, he served as a volunteer basketball coach and basketball coordinator
at the Blue Island Recreation Center, overseeing teams from K-12th grade, and
helping the program's overall growth and participation. He is currently the
director of basketball operations at the Illinois Basketball Academy in
Naperville.
Shannon was a three-sport athlete at Eisenhower
High School, including being a team captain for football, basketball and
baseball and an all-conference selection for basketball during his senior year.
Coach Shannon also captained the Cyclones'
1995-96 team.
"I believe in balancing hard work, physical
preparation, and a commitment to academics," Shannon said. Armed with that
philosophy, he has helped players attain their goals on the court and in the
classroom.
